oracle - 如何在 Oracle SQL Developer 中建立本地连接?
问题描述
我已经下载了 SQL Developer。目前,我正在使用我的学校数据库,但它是临时使用的。我想在大学毕业后使用它。我不知道如何在 SQL Developer 中建立本地连接。你能帮我解决这个问题吗?
解决方案
Oracle SQL Developer 是用于访问 Oracle 数据库的工具。
因此,如果您想在自己的计算机上使用 Oracle,无论是否连接到您的学校网络,您还必须安装数据库。我建议使用 Oracle 11g Express Edition。安装过程简单;或多或少,点击 NEXT 几次就可以了。不过,我建议您遵循安装指南并注意安装程序的要求(例如,写下您选择的密码)。
此外,为了将数据库(实际上,我相信您在这种情况下的意思是“模式”)“复制”到您的数据库,正确的方法是使用数据泵。您将在学校使用 Export 来导出数据库,并在您的计算机上使用 Import 来导入它。
但是,由于 Data Pump 需要访问目录(它是指向文件系统目录的 Oracle 对象,通常位于数据库服务器上;它由 SYS 创建,其他用户被授予读取和/或写入权限)。如果您无法访问它,您可以使用原始的EXP 和 IMP 实用程序。EXP 在本地创建 DMP 文件;你可以把它放到记忆棒上(或者,如果你在网络上,把它直接复制到你的电脑上)并导入它。
如果您不确定是否可以(或不能)这样做,请询问您的老师。
将架构导入数据库后,使用 SQL Developer 访问它。这样做应该没问题。
推荐阅读
- rabbitmq - 带有 RabbitMQ 插件的 ThingsBoard
- javascript - React 组件 HTML 内容来自 GET 请求,我需要以某种方式从 HTML 元素中删除一个元素
- javascript - Laravel 混合,使用许多输出文件进行更快的 sass 编译
- python - Azure 中的问题在小型 csv 上使用 Python 的 read_csv 部署了 Databricks。Py4j:获取新通信通道时出错
- amazon-web-services - 在 AWS Code Pipeline 中集成漏洞扫描
- security - SAML 断言中的 SAML 2.0 摘要值计算
- matlab - 如何绘制 ODE 系统解的分量的导数?
- google-chrome - 如何禁用 Lingocloud - 自动翻译页面内容的 Web 翻译扩展
- angular - 我想在 Mat Table 中选择基于角度下拉值的选择
- c# - CardSpaceException: 没有发现机器上安装了 CardSpace 服务的版本